Breakdown of Key Nodes in the Import Process
The import of mechanical equipment involves22 Standard Operating Procedures, among which three critical nodes directly impact customs clearance efficiency:
Pre - classification stage
The 2025 edition of the HS code has added 12 new mechanical subcategories.
The misclassification rate of laser cutting equipment remains high at 38%.
Document review stage
Certificate of OriginThe verification time for authenticity has been shortened to 1.5 working days.
The new version of the CE certification must include a QR code verification module.
On - site inspection stage
The coverage rate of the Customs Intelligent Inspection System has reached 87%.
Incorrect IPPC markings on wooden packaging still account for 62% of non-compliant declarations.
Golden Standard for Document Preparation
Announcement No. 34 of the General Administration of Customs in 2025 explicitly requires that mechanical import documents must include:
New VersionApplication form for import of electromechanical products(Including 3D equipment structure diagram)
EU CE certification or US UL certificationDigitally signed version
Energy Consumption Test Report of Equipment (Compliant with GB 21455-2025 Standard)
Cross-border transportation insurance policy (with an insured amount not less than 130% of the CIF value)
